I recently found out that like myself, others are missing weapons skills that should have been attained once reaching a certain mastery lvl with a weapon. I was lvling my club with my monk. When I reached (and even surpassed) lv40 with it I shoulda got Seraph Strike, but did not. The battle log said I learned it, but it never showed up (and still hasn't) in my WS menu. Similarly and monk I partied with surpass lv70 with h2h and didn't receive Inch Punch. Does anyone out there have any idea as to what's up? Or Does anyone have any similar stories to share?

Some weapon skills are exclusive to certain jobs. For instance, Red Lotus Blade (Sword skill) is exclusive to Warrior, Paladin, and Dark Knight I believe. As a Red Mage, I learned the skill but cannot use it. If I subbed even a level 1 Warrior I'd earn the skill though.

Seraph Strike is only available to WHM, WAR, PLD, DRK, SAM.

Exclusive skills are granted to those jobs whose main proficiencies lie in the given weapon skill. This page is a good resource:

Interesting. I knew that ranged weapons skills were exclusive to Rangers, but I didn't know about the Seraph Strike exclusivity. Does this mean that if a lvl a mage and use my club, Seraph Strike should be available to me?
#4 Jan 14 2004 at 10:49 AM Rating: Decent
*
92 posts
Yes, as long as your proficiency with club is high enough. Which it would be when you reach level 14 WHM.
